Scary Kids Scaring Kids debut EP gets vinyl release with four new songs
Scary Kids Scaring Kids have announced the first-ever vinyl release for their iconic debut EP, After Dark.
Not only will it be the first time the EP will be on vinyl, but it’ll feature four previously unreleased bonus tracks as well.

Scary Kids Scaring Kids’ debut EP was self-financed by the band while they were in high school. Two years later, it was reissued by Immortal Records, and now it’s officially getting a vinyl release.
The After Dark EP reissue includes a song lyrics insert, rare photos, set lists, show flyers and handwritten lyrics. The release also includes a digital download card.
Each album is pressed on 140 gram colored vinyl and housed in a jacket featuring all new art, reimagined by Zachary Brown.

Side A:
What's Up Now
Bulletproof
Locked In
Sink And Die
Changing Priorities
Side B:
My Knife, Your Throat
Pass You By (Unreleased Demo)
The World As We Know It (SoCal Demo)
My Knife, Your Throat (SoCal Demo)
Changing Priorities (MCC Demo)
